/*-----------Media multi-------------*/
@media screen and (max-width: 1300px) { 
	
	#danhmuc{
		width:100%;
	}
	.margin_auto{
		width:100%;
	}
	#timkiem{
		width:35%;
		background-size:100%;
	}
	#timkiem button{
		  
	}
	#timkiem input{
		    width: 220px;
			height: 23px;
			line-height: 21px;
	}
	.giaohang{
		  width: 35%;
	}
	.box_x{
		width:85px !important;
	}
	.box_rp1{
		width:85px !important;
	}
	.slide_show{
		width:730px;
	}
	#slide_show{
		width:730px;
	}
	.chinhsach img{
		max-width:50%;
	}
	.chu_h3{
		width:100%;
	}
	.sanphamnb{
		width:100%;
	}
	.item_sp{
		width:240px;
		text-align:center;
		
	}
	.img_sp img{
		max-width:100%;
		margin:20px 0px;
	}
	.sanpham_dm{
		width:100%;
	}
	.khung_qc{
		width:29%;
	}
	.khung_sp{
		width:70%;
	}
	.khung_qc img{
		max-width:100%;
	}
	.icon_w{
		width:100%;
	}
	.menu_gt{
		width:100%;
	}
	.item{
		width:25%;
		min-height:260px;
		
	}
	.item h3, .sp2 h3{
		height:65px;
		overflow:hidden;
	}
	.item  a img{
		max-width:100%;
		height:auto;
	}
	.box_cauhoi_index{
		width:240px;
	}
	.box_cauhoi_index img{
		max-width:100%;
		height:auto;
	
	}
	.box_con_w{
		margin-right:65px;
	}
	.box_menu {
		float: left;
		width: 19%;
		margin-right: 36px;
		margin-left: 10px;
	}
	.asd{
		width:28% !important;
	}
	.lienket img{
		height:35px;
	}
	.box_menu h2{
		font-size:13px;
	}
	.box_menu h4{
		font-size:13px;
	}
	.footer{
		padding-left:10px;
	}
	#ct_sanpham{
		width:75%;
	}
	.sanphamcl{
		width:23%;
	}
	.box_ykien{
		margin-left:0px !important;
	}
	.box_ykien span{
		font-size:13px;
	}
	.lh{
		font-size:13px;
	}
	
	.box_ykien{
		margin-left:0px !important;
		width:80%;
	}
}
@media screen and (max-width: 1024px) {
	.box_ykien{
		margin-left:0px !important;
		width:80%;
	}
	.box_ykien span{
		font-size:13px;
	}
	.lh{
		font-size:13px;
	}
	.r_left{
	float:right;
	width:100%;
}
	.dm_ct{
		display:none;
	}
	.cot_l{
		display:none;
	}
	.cot_c{
		width:70%;
	}
	.cot_r{
		width:29%;
	}
	#top_wrap{
		padding:0px 10px;
	}
	.margin_auto{
		width:100%;
	}
	#danhmuc{
		width:100%;
	}
	#timkiem{
		width:35%;
		background-size:100%;
	}
	#timkiem button{
		   
	}
	#timkiem input{
		    width: 50%;
			height: 23px;
			line-height: 21px;
	}
	.giaohang{
		    width: 35%;
	}
	.box_x{
		width:85px !important;
	}
	.box_rp1{
		width:85px !important;
	}
	.slide_show{
		width:730px;
	}
	#slide_show{
		width:730px;
	}
	.chinhsach img{
		max-width:50%;
	}
	.chu_h3{
		width:100%;
	}
	.sanphamnb{
		width:100%;
	}
	.item_sp{
		width:240px;
		text-align:center;
		
	}
	.img_sp img{
		max-width:100%;
		margin:20px 0px;
	}
	.sanpham_dm{
		width:100%;
	}
	.khung_qc{
		width:29%;
	}
	.khung_sp{
		width:70%;
	}
	.khung_qc img{
		max-width:100%;
	}
	.icon_w{
		width:100%;
	}
	.menu_gt{
		width:100%;
	}
	.item{
		width:175px;
		min-height:260px;
		
	}
	.item h3, .sp2 h3{
		height:65px;
		overflow:hidden;
	}
	.item  a img{
		max-width:100%;
		height:auto;
	}
	.box_cauhoi_index{
		width:240px;
	}
	.box_cauhoi_index img{
		max-width:100%;
		height:auto;
	
	}
	.box_con_w{
		margin-right:65px;
	}
	.box_menu {
		float: left;
		width: 19%;
		margin-right: 36px;
		margin-left: 10px;
	}
	.asd{
		width:28% !important;
	}
	.lienket img{
		height:35px;
	}
	.box_menu h2{
		font-size:13px;
	}
	.box_menu h4{
		font-size:13px;
	}
	.footer{
		padding-left:10px;
	}
	#ct_sanpham{
		width:75%;
	}
	.sanphamcl{
		width:23%;
	}
	
	
}
@media screen and (max-width: 980px) {
	.dm_ct{
		display:none;
	}
		.giaohang{
			width:350px;
		}
		.asd{
			width:26% !important;
		}
		#show-message-action-cart{
			display:none;
		}
		#container{
			overflow:hidden;
		}
		.sp_left{
			display:none;
		}
		.sp_right{
			width:100%;
		}
		.item_pro{
			width:220px;
		}
		.giaohang{
			width:340px;
			margin-left:0px;
		}
		.box_con_w{
			margin-right:50px;
		}
		#slide_show{
			width:70%;
		}
		#slide_show img{
		
		}
		.khung_qc {
			display:none;
		}
		.khung_sp{
			width:100%;
		}
		.item{
			width:24%;
		}
		#logo{
			width:22%;
		}
		#timkiem{
			
			margin-right:10px;
		}
		#menu_left{
			width:28%;
		}
	#menu_dm{
		width:100%;
	}
}
/*-----------------landscape size for screen device and browsers-------------*/	

@media  (max-width: 800px) {
	.winput{
		margin-bottom:5px;
	}
	.search-input {
    min-width: 41%;
}
	.khung_phai{
		width:99%;
	}
	.khung_trai{
		width:99%;
	}
	.r_left{
	float:right;
	width:100%;
}
	
	.cot_c{
		width:100%;
	}
	.cot_r{
		display:none;
	}
	.sanphamcl{
		width:100%;
	}
	.w200{
		width:32% !important;
	}
	#ct_sanpham{
		width:100%;
	}
	.chu_dieuhuong{
		width:100%;
	}
	.giaohang{
		display:none;
	}
	#menu_left{
		display:none;
	}
	#slide_show{
		width:100%;
	}
	.khung_qc {
		display:none;
	}
	.khung_sp{
		width:100%;
		padding-left:20px;
	}
	.item{
		width:24%;
		min-height:265px;
	}
	.box_con_w{
		margin-right:5px;
	}
	.box_menu{
		width:43%;
	}
	.asd{
		width:43% !important;
	}
	.footer-whats{
		 -webkit-column-count: 2; /* Chrome, Safari, Opera */
    -moz-column-count: 2; /* Firefox */
    column-count: 2,
	color: #888;
    font-weight: 300;
    font-size: 11px;
	line-height:25px;
	
	-webkit-column-gap: 70px; /* Chrome, Safari, Opera */
    -moz-column-gap: 70px; /* Firefox */
    column-gap: 70px;
	}
	.sp_left{
		display:none;
	}
	.sp_right{
		width:100%;
	}
	.item_pro{
		width:23%;
		margin-left:5px;
	}
	#responsive-menu{
		display:block !important;
	}
	#timkiem{
		width:40%;
	}
}

/*-----------Media multi-------------*/
@media screen and (max-width: 768px) {
	.frame_images{
		width:100%;
	}
	.widget_info_prod{
		width:100%;
	}
	.share{
		width:100%;
		display:block;
		float:left;
	}
	.danhmuc_ct{
		display:none;
	}
	.selectors{
		display:none;
	}
	.item_pro{
		margin-left:1%;
		width:30%;
	}
	.bo{
		margin-right:13px !important;
	}
	
}
/*-----------------landscape size for tablet-------------*/
@media screen and (max-width: 600px) {
	.sp_right{
		width:100%;
	}
	.sp_left{
		display:none;
	}
	.item{
		width:48%;
		min-height:265px;
	}
	.icon_w{
		height: auto;
    min-height: 210px;
    background-size: 100%;
	}
	.box_menu{
		width:40%;
	}
	
	#timkiem{
		margin-top:5px;
		width:45%;
	}
	.item_pro{
		margin-left:5%;
		width:30%;
	}
	
	
	
}
/*-----------------landscape size for Mobile-------------*/
@media screen and (max-width: 480px) {
	.item_pro{
		width:100%;
	}
	.app-figure{
		width:100%;
	}
	.w200{
		width:90% !important;
	}
	
	.header_top{
		min-height:215px;
	}
	#top_wrap span{
		display:inline-block;
	}
	.hot_l{
		float:left;
		margin-left:10px;
		display:inline-block;
		text-align:left !important;
	}
	#top_wrap{
		height:auto;
	}
	#show-message-action-cart{
		display:none;
	}
	#logo img, #banner img{
		display:inline-block;
	}
	#logo{
		width:100%;
		text-align:center;
	}
	#timkiem{
		display:none;
	}
	.copy b{
		    width: 100%;
    display: block;
    float: left;
    font-size: 12px;
	}
	.box_cauhoi_index{
		width:90%;
		margin-left:5%;
	}
	.asd{
		width:90% !important;
	}
	.box_menu{
		width:90%;
	}
	.icon_w{
		min-height:310px;
	}
	.footer-whats{
		 -webkit-column-count: 1; /* Chrome, Safari, Opera */
    -moz-column-count: 1; /* Firefox */
    column-count: 1,
	color: #888;
    font-weight: 300;
    font-size: 11px;
	line-height:25px;
	
	-webkit-column-gap: 70px; /* Chrome, Safari, Opera */
    -moz-column-gap: 70px; /* Firefox */
    column-gap: 70px;
	}
	
	.item{
		width:98%;
		min-height:265px;
	}
	
}

/*-----------Media multi-------------*/
@media screen and (max-width: 360px) {
	
}

